Position Description

As a Listed Trader, you will play a key role in supporting the desk’s trading activities and risk management processes. This position offers exposure to cutting-edge strategies and tools, providing an excellent platform for career growth in a high-energy environment. This is a fast-paced and exciting new role designed for individuals eager to make an impact in the equity derivatives space.

Key Areas of Responsibilities

  • Maintain and calibrate volatility surfaces to support accurate option pricing across underlyings.

  • Assist in optimizing trade execution and reconciliation workflows.

  • Build and improve on-desk tools for real-time risk monitoring.

  • Execute trades and manage interactions with counterparties.

  • Support development and testing of proprietary strategies.

  • Collaborate with internal teams to streamline trading processes.

  • Monitor market conditions and liquidity to identify opportunities and manage risk.

  • Analyze option flow and volatility trends to provide insights to senior traders.

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ree or higher (Master’s preferred) in Mathematics, Statistics, Finance, or a related field.

  • Strong work ethic, self-motivation, and eagerness to learn.

  • Minimum 3 years of experience in Equity Derivatives, ideally with Listed Options trading exposure.

  • Solid understanding of Single Stock and Index Option pricing and volatility models.

  • Strong analytical, quantitative, and interpersonal skills.

  • Ability to perform under pressure and work effectively in a team environment.

  • Excellent communication skills, both written and spoken, in English.

  • Proficient in Python for data analysis (NumPy, Pandas, Polars), SQL/database design, and object-oriented programming with solid grasp of software design patterns

What you need to know about the London Tech Scene

London isn't just a hub for established businesses; it's also a nursery for innovation. Boasting one of the most recognized fintech ecosystems in Europe, attracting billions in investments each year, London's success has made it a go-to destination for startups looking to make their mark. Top U.K. companies like Hoptin, Moneybox and Marshmallow have already made the city their base — yet fintech is just the beginning. From healthtech to renewable energy to cybersecurity and beyond, the city's startups are breaking new ground across a range of industries.
